Foil Dessert

Prep: 10 min Cook: 10 min Cuisine: American

A fun and indulgent foil dessert featuring warm glazed donuts filled with pineapple and melted marshmallows, perfect for camping or casual gatherings with sweet, gooey flavors.

Ingredients

  • glazed donuts
  • sliced pineapple
  • large marshmallows

Instructions

  1. Slice the glazed donut in half lengthwise.
  2. Place one slice of pineapple between the donut halves.
  3. Fill the donut 'hole' with large marshmallows.
  4. Wrap the assembled donut and fillings in aluminum foil.
  5. Place in hot coals for about 5 to 10 minutes until warm and marshmallows are melted.

Tips & Substitutions

For a fun twist, try using other fruits like peaches or strawberries instead of pineapple. You can also substitute the glazed donuts with chocolate or cinnamon rolls for varied flavors. Serving Suggestions

Serve the foil dessert warm, straight from the coals or oven, for the best experience. It pairs wonderfully with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or whipped cream on the side. Storage & Reheating

Leftovers should be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to two days. To reheat, unwrap the foil and place the dessert on a baking sheet in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 5-7 minutes, or until warmed through and the marshmallows are gooey again.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I make this dessert ahead of time?

It's best to assemble the dessert just before cooking, as the donuts may become soggy if left with the pineapple and marshmallows for too long. However, you can prep the ingredients in advance and store them separately until you're ready to cook.

What if I don’t have access to coals?

If coals aren’t available, you can bake the wrapped dessert in an o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10-15 minutes. Just keep an eye on it to ensure the marshmallows melt without burning.

Can I use other types of donuts?

Absolutely! While glazed donuts add sweetness and moisture, feel free to experiment with other flavors like jelly-filled or even cake donuts. Just be mindful of the flavor combinations with your fruit and marshmallows.
